BP112950 - 11 Buttertubs -- Scanned
Neighbourhood: University District    
Street Address: 11 Buttertubs -- Scanned
Type of Application: Commercial / Multi-Res Alteration
File Number: BP112950
Date Application Submitted: May 29, 2008
Application Description: 42 residential units and 2 laundry buildings are being upgraded. Upgrades include a new fire protection sprinkler system, replacing bathtubs with accessible showers, and other minor items.

See BP112272 for the Civil Engineering.

Group C Building, BCBC 3.2.2.57
Application Status: COMPLETED
Permit Value: $1,000,000.00
Builder: FISK CONSTRUCTION INC
Issued Date: July 09, 2008
File Close Date: November 28, 2012
